中文摘要:
      本文应用边界元法计算了强震下流体的非线性晃动及其对槽身的水平力及翻转力矩,将所得数值结果与线性解析方法的计算结果作了比较,分析了两类结果的异同点。计算表明:强震时,流体对槽身可能会产生很大的横向水平力,建议在抗震设计时考虑这一作用因素。
英文摘要:
      The boundary element method is applied to simulate nonlinear sloshing of fluid, dynamic horizontal force and overturning moment acting on the aqueduct body during earthquake. The computational results of BEM (nonlinear) are compared with that of linearized theories. The numerical results reveal that a great horizontal force acting on the aqueduct body may occurred during strong earthquake. This action must be considered in seismic resistance design.
